Ramon Sessions and Steve Blake each hit late 3-pointers Sunday, sending the Los Angeles Lakers to a 92-88 win over Denver and a 3-1 playoff series lead. Sessions' trey with 48 seconds remaining put the Lakers ahead to stay at 89-86, and after Denver's Andre Miller was called for offensive goaltending, Blake sealed the Lakers' win with another 3-pointer. Sessions finished with 12 points. Blake scored eight of his 10 points in the fourth quarter for the Lakers, who will try to close out their Western Conference quarterfinal series when they host Tuesday's Game 5. Kobe Bryant supplied 22 points, eight rebounds and six assists, while Andrew Bynum added 19 points and seven boards in the victory. Danilo Gallinari led the Nuggets with 20 points.
